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
420685 9557 89012 57235
57823780 686235256
57823780 686235256
0411 2262 37629
All about undefined
Interested in learning more?
57823780 686235256
0411 2262 37629
See more
2304 89023505633 389617
9742 12 81600 51695
See more
1476796374 06145417156 759661573
86377680977 616724934 16962 7747
See more